How can I convert 1 dollar into cryptocurrencies?
I have 1 dollar and I want to invest it in cryptocurrencies. How can I convert this small amount of money into cryptocurrencies? What are the options available for me to get started with cryptocurrency investments?
3 answers
- Marc Jean Joseph DelgadoNov 27, 2023 · 3 years agoIf you have 1 dollar and want to invest it in cryptocurrencies, you have a few options. One option is to use a cryptocurrency exchange platform like Binance or BYDFi. These platforms allow you to convert your dollars into cryptocurrencies by trading them for popular c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. Simply create an account, deposit your 1 dollar, and start trading. Keep in mind that there may be fees associated with trading on these platforms. Another option is to use a peer-to-peer marketplace like LocalBitcoins or Paxful. These platforms conn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ing you to find someone willing to sell you cryptocurrencies in exchange for your 1 dollar. This method may require more effort and research to find a trustworthy seller. Lastly, you can consider using cryptocurrency faucets or earning platforms. These platforms allow you to earn small amounts of cryptocurrencies by completing tasks or watching ads. While it may take some time to accumulate a significant amount, it's a way to get started with cryptocurrencies without investing a lot of money.
- Skaaning JacobsonOct 30, 2024 · 2 years agoConverting 1 dollar into cryptocurrencies can be a challenge due to the low amount. However, there are still options available for you. One option is to look for a cryptocurrency exchange that allows you to trade small amounts. Some exchanges have a minimum deposit requirement, so make sure to check their policies before creating an account. Additionally, you can consider using a cryptocurrency wallet that supports microtransactions. These wallets allow you to store and transact small amounts of cryptocurrencies, making it easier to manage your 1 dollar investment. Another option is to join cryptocurrency airdrops or bounty programs. These programs distribute free tokens to participants as a way to promote their projects. While the amount you receive may vary, it's a way to get started with cryptocurrencies without spending any money. Keep in mind that not all airdrops and bounty programs are legitimate, so do your research and only participate in reputable ones. Remember, investing in cryptocurrencies involves risks, and it's important to do your own research and only invest what you can afford to lose.
